Output 081128600a127b228b5420df26344076e65cd9fca7fe774378c4c6bbe38c108e:0

value
39136894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a29a30eb5b421d4b28320fa56f34050e9b2e5bbd OP_EQUAL
address
3GWn71FUiR8KtZ2gqQso9ExGL7orrBMK1t
transaction
081128600a127b228b5420df26344076e65cd9fca7fe774378c4c6bbe38c108e
confirmations
173455
spent
true